I need to know the conditions of storage isolated mitochondria with the highest activity.
Also, the suitable time to work on it without significant damage.

Isolated mitochondria should basically not be stored whenever possible.
Even storage on ice inactivates activity extremely quickly.
It is better to perform the experiments immediately after they are isolated to obtain reliable results.
